Why Your Ring Doorbell is Not Charging

The Ring Doorbell operates on a built-in rechargeable battery. It’s designed to charge itself when hardwired to an existing doorbell circuit. However, various factors can disrupt this charging process, leaving your device drained and non-functional.

Common Reasons Behind Your Ring Doorbell’s Charging Issues

Several factors can contribute to your Ring Doorbell’s charging issues. These can range from technical glitches and outdated firmware to adverse weather conditions and poor Wi-Fi connection.

Is Your Ring Doorbell Firmware Up-to-Date?

One of the first things to check is your Ring Doorbell’s firmware. Outdated firmware can cause a myriad of issues, including charging problems. Ensure your device is running the latest firmware version to rule out this potential issue.

Evaluating the Role of Weather Conditions on Ring Doorbell Charging

Extreme weather conditions can also affect your Ring Doorbell’s charging ability. Cold temperatures can slow down the charging process, while excessive heat can cause the device to stop charging altogether to prevent damage.
